Introduction
Hydrofluorocarbons (HFCs) have become a focal point in the global fight against climate change. The EPA’s “Operation: Disrupt HFCs” targets these substances, primarily used in refrigeration and air conditioning systems, which have contributed significantly to greenhouse gas emissions. In light of the Kigali Amendment to the Montreal Protocol, which aims to phase out HFCs globally, the U.S. initiative aligns with international climate commitments while addressing domestic environmental goals.
Key Developments
As part of this initiative, the EPA has proposed a phasedown rule that seeks to reduce HFC production and consumption by 85% over the next 15 years. This regulation is expected to impact approximately 4.2 billion tons of CO2 equivalent emissions over the next three decades. The phasedown is anticipated to decrease the market for HFCs from a projected $8.3 billion in 2021 to around $5 billion by 2036, indicating a significant contraction in this segment.
- 85% reduction in HFC production and consumption by 2036.
- Projected decline of the HFC market from $8.3 billion to $5 billion.
- 4.2 billion tons of CO2 equivalent emissions reduced over 30 years.
Market Impact Analysis
The operation is poised to disrupt the HFC market significantly, leading to increased demand for alternative refrigerants such as natural refrigerants (e.g., ammonia, CO2, hydrocarbons) and hydrofluoroolefins (HFOs). As companies pivot to comply with EPA regulations, investments in R&D for sustainable alternatives are expected to surge, potentially creating a new multi-billion dollar industry. Moreover, companies failing to adapt may face financial penalties, market share losses, and reputational damage.
The cost of compliance and transition to alternative technologies is a critical consideration for industries reliant on HFCs. For instance, the initial transition costs for businesses could average between $2,000 to $5,000 per refrigerant system. However, these expenses may be offset by long-term savings on energy efficiency and maintenance, as newer systems using alternatives typically perform better and are less costly to operate over time.
